The Pittsburgh Steelers are entering the NFL playoffs as a Wild Card team, facing the Houston Texans. Their postseason journey is significantly bolstered by the return of key wide receiver DK Metcalf, who missed the final two regular-season games due to suspension. His absence had contributed to the Steelers' offensive struggles in generating impactful plays.
Metcalf's return is timely, providing the Steelers with a much-needed dynamic weapon. His ability to stretch defenses and win one-on-one matchups is crucial against a physical Texans defense. This addition is expected to allow other offensive players to settle into more natural roles, improving the overall passing game's consistency and effectiveness.
With Metcalf back, the Steelers appear better prepared for the high-stakes environment of playoff football. A victory against the Texans would advance them to a Divisional Round game on the road against the New England Patriots. This return marks a critical moment for Pittsburgh as they aim to make a deep postseason run.
